Cartier-Bresson, a symbol to street digital photographers of everywhere, suggests that there is an instant where every element of a scene forms, with the resulting image communicating the recorded occasion with perfect clarity. In his publication, aptly entitled The Decisive Minute (1952 ), Cartier-Bresson compares catching the definitive minute to hunting, "I lurked the streets ready to strike, established to 'trap' life." His tool of choice, the mighty (and stealthy) Leica M3 with a typical 50mm lens, enabled Cartier-Bresson to "fade right into the background," patiently waiting on the crucial moment prior to trapping it permanently on a roll of movie, without alerting a heart.

The introduction of the mobile video camera in the very early 1900s made it feasible for professional photographers to record candid moments on the streets. Leaders such as Eugene Atget and Henri Cartier-Bresson in the 1920s and 30s led the way for modern-day road photography, utilizing handheld video cameras to capture day-to-day life in the cities they lived in.

Simply snapping a photo of a road scene isn't sufficient to produce a good street photo. There are numerous components of street digital photography that, when integrated, can aid create powerful images. Efficient road photography: Has a clear topic. Your street photograph should have a solid emphasis on the subject or scene you're photographing.

Road digital photography should inform stories with its images. It's your task as a road professional photographer to catch minutes that stimulate feeling in the audience, making them really feel something when checking out your street photograph. Papers human life. Road digital photography is a way to record the lives and tales of everyday people.
Image by Derek Lee When it concerns street digital photography, you do not need one of read the article the most expensive equipment to begin. Road digital photography is often seen as a workout in minimalism the much less equipment you have, the much better. That's because street photography has to do with being able to move promptly and blend into the road scene
